Deslie Bonano Broussard, LCSW, CCTS, BCD

 

     Deslie Bonano Broussard's scope of practice includes treating mood disorders, ADHD, adjustment issues, anxiety, Asperger's/Autism and abuse, adoption home studies in Louisiana and Mississippi. 

     Deslie attended Tulane University and The University of New Orleans, graduating with a bachelor's degree in psychology. She earned a master's degree in Social Work from the University of Southern Mississippi and is a Board Certified Diplomat in Clinical Social Work and a Certified Clinical Trauma Specialist. She is a member of the International Association of Trauma Professionals and a member of the Mississippi Conference on Social Welfare. Deslie is licensed in the states of Mississippi and Louisiana.  She has previous experience working with the Department of Human Services in The Family Preservation Division and The Adoption Unit. Deslie has also worked with the Child Abuse Education Counsel in Pearl River County, Mississippi. She has been providing psychotherapy services in a private practice setting since 2002. 

Dr. Rhonda Sanders, Ed.D., LCSW, CTS

    Rhonda Sanders' scope of practice includes grief and loss, trauma, adjustment issues, ADHD, depression and anxiety. She also provides group therapy to adolescent teens to teach self awareness, confidence and social skills.

    She attended the University of Southern Mississippi, earning a masters degree in Social Work. She also attended Nova Southern University, graduating with a Doctorate  in Education with a specialty in Child, Youth, and Human Services. Dr. Sanders is a member of the Academy of Certified Social Workers. She has been in private practice serving adults, children and adolescents since 2007.

Paula Duchmann, LCSW 

           Paula Duchmann attended The University of Southern Mississippi, graduating with a bachelor's degree in social work. After being accepted into the advance standing program, she completed her master's degree. She has experience as a school social worker and school based clinician, as well as an advocate with the school system. Paula's practice includes working with children, adults and families. Her scope of practice includes ADHD, adjustment disorders, depression, anxiety, mood disorders, anger management, behavior disorders and marital therapy,

Shannon Slizoski, LMFT

       Shannon's current areas of practice include adjustment issues, mood disorders, ADHD, OCD, as well as marital and family issues. She works with individuals, couples and families using a systems approach.

     Ms. Slizoski graduated from the University of Southern Mississippi with a master's degree in marriage and family therapy. She is a Licensed Marriage and Family Therapist and a member of the American Association for Marriage and Family Therapists.
